Commissioned by a Chicago area client in 2001, this is a big, bold lamp. The 22″ Nasturtium shade is a pattern that lends itself to strong colors and an interesting variety of glass. Rippled and textured glass give the shade a three dimensional look that is accentuated by the strong color choices.
The Mosaic Turtleback base is, according to our client, “The Mother of all bases!” We agree that this large base has all the bells and whistles. Created in our studio using molds taken off an original Tiffany example, this is the most expensive base we offer.
